Melanin is mainly produced as a result of the body breaking down a type of protein molecule called tyrosine. Adding foods to your diet that are rich in tyrosine can help to increase melanin production, such as fish, eggs, beans, nuts, and dairy products. According to a study published in the journal BMC Genomics, 14.3% of people between the ages of 18 and 30 were found to have gray hair. Young males (17.8%) were found to have significantly more gray hair than young females (9.2%).
